Our take

Zipline is transforming the way goods move by creating the first logistics system that serves all humans equally via a drone delivery service. As the first emergency drone logistics operation, Zipline is fundamentally changing how we transport emergency medical supplies and has expanded into commercial deliveries. It's partnered with several major companies, including Walmart.

Zipline has an edge over potential future competitors as the company has thousands of hours and over 35 million miles of flight to prove the system is safe and effective. It’s also one of the first companies to receive a full commercial operating certificate, putting Zipline in a strong position to continuously branch out to other markets.

The unicorn company operates globally and has signed its first government contract with Rwanda to provide up to 2 million drone deliveries by 2029. It is also aiming to start commercial deliveries to individual households in the near future. With big companies such as Amazon and Walmart examining “instant” delivery options, Zipline has a proven track record and the equipment and logistics in place to provide such services. 2023 funding pushed Zipline's valuation to a staggering $4.2 billion, indicating a bright future.
